Tiivistelmä:As a natural consequence of labor shortage pressure, small enterprises tried to ease this pressure with the introduction of industrial robots. Japan is a good place to study the socioeconomic implications of robotization, and a project was initiated with this purpose in mind. Taking this situation into account, robotization as an economic process and its economic impact are quantitatively analyzed. An overview of robotization is taken focusing on the two main robot-using industries. The data base is twofold, the first being the results of a former survey. The second source is derived from interviews with engineers, mostly from within the electrical and automobile industries.
